WebSep 30, 2024 · The Derwent Procolour lightfast rating ranges from 1 (being the lowest lightfast rating) up to 8 (being the highest lightfast rating). Of this 72 pencil set, the Derwent Procolour manufacturer’s colour chart states pencils with a lightfast rating of 6 and above to be highly lightfast.
